Last Fall a long time Central Region bonus center had the clarity and wisdom to grieve out bonus in my building.
Now, for some reason (our bumbling BA), the drivers in this center think that they can "ungrieve" bonus back in???
Several hedge hoppers have solicited 40 grievances asking for bonus to be reinstated and they have been submitted and are being entertained by the Local, who may have actually provided these hedge hoppers with the pre-printed grievance forms.
I have read, and reread Article 19 sec 10 of the Central Region Supplement and just don't see how this is possible?
What I see when I read Article 19 sec 10, is that the powers that be understood that bonus is the scourge of all UPS contracts.
Bonus promotes unsafe and dishonest behavior and is by far the most hypocritical program imaginable for a company who claims to put "safety first".
These bonus/incentive programs also allows the company to "arbitrarily negotiate" different rates of pay for individual drivers on individual routes, while failing to take into consideration age, gender and physical condition.
For a union who claims that they don't recognize production standards, how can they endorse any company plan whose standards aren't negotiated?
The way that Article 19 sec 10 is written, it is clear to me that it provides for a way out of bonus plans, as well providing an avenue for any savvy local to make sure no new bonus/incentive plans are ever implemented or "reimplemented" in any center in the future.
I'm so tired of short sighted politics being put ahead of what is obviously the right thing to do, or not to do.
What am I missing?
